As the name suggests, it also uses a wider frequency. The frequency range of Ultra-wideband is … WebEight human subjects performing eight different activities are measured using a UWB radar. The eight activities include walking, running, rotating, punching, jumping, transitioning between standing and sitting, crawling and standing still. The dimension of the UWB returns is reduced using principal component analysis (PCA).

Ultra-wideband (UWB) microwave imaging is a TD technique. It uses a pulsed-radar approach to identify the location of regions of increased scattering (scatterers) within the sample rather than aiming at the complete information of the spatial permittivity distribution [109–111].
